Output e8a061d3e7e403bf42a5245432ba7dcabf232c16db877b070cbbf250baaf1600:1

value
15885034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edcc98c2f9f1f6ec7e97074fa69151894f6c9637 OP_EQUAL
address
3PNPAduvrfTRSEhsttHnbc4znMdvJWmYzm
transaction
e8a061d3e7e403bf42a5245432ba7dcabf232c16db877b070cbbf250baaf1600
confirmations
297528
spent
true